What is Áo phao cứu sinh?
In this glossary, Áo phao cứu sinh refers to: Personal flotation device provided to each occupant for use during water ditching or sea evacuation.
How is Áo phao cứu sinh used in aviation?
In aviation communication, this term appears in contexts such as: "Tiếp viên xác minh mỗi hành khách có áo phao dưới ghế và hướng dẫn cách mặc đúng trong buổi hướng dẫn an toàn."
